2. Challenges Of Reusing Solar Panels
It is widely accepted that recycling photovoltaic panels has numerous environmental benefits, nevertheless, it is additionally true that the procedure isn't without its difficulties. But what exactly are these challenges? Allow's examine further.
One of the most significant concerns with recycling solar panels is the complexity of the job itself. It can be tough to break down the various elements, such as glass and metal, to be recycled individually. In addition, photovoltaic panel suppliers frequently have a mix of materials made use of in their products which makes sorting them a lot more challenging. In addition, there are safety and security and health and wellness dangers included with handling busted glass or breathing in fumes from thawing parts.

3. Techniques For Recycling Solar Panels
As the world pursues an extra sustainable future, reusing photovoltaic panels is an increasingly prominent job. In the middle of this growing interest, nonetheless, we need to take into consideration the strategies that are in location to make it feasible.
To start with, several companies have executed a 'take-back' system where old or broken photovoltaic panels can be accumulated and sent out to their respective factories for recycling. This way, the products have the ability to be reused in the construction of brand-new products. Additionally, some districts have actually also begun providing rewards for individuals wishing to reuse their photovoltaic panels; this can vary from tax breaks to free delivery costs.
Furthermore, technology has actually ended up being progressively advanced when it comes to recycling photovoltaic panels-- with specialised devices with the ability of separating out all the different components within them. For example, by using AI-powered robotic arms, these machines can draw out helpful materials such as copper and aluminium while also taking care of hazardous waste safely.
